Abstract

Background: Coronary artery bypass grafting (CABG) can be performed through a variety of approaches. Minimally‐invasive CABG (MICABG) may reduce perioperative morbidity. Previous results demonstrate improved perioperative outcomes; however, adoption has been limited.
